COMMUNITY NEWS
- ➤ The Helena Turkey Trot, a long-standing Thanksgiving fun run, aims to support local charities with events including a choice of 1k, 5k, or 10k runs and a festive drawing for pies and turkeys. KTVH
- ➤ Helena's Parade of Lights and Fire Tower lighting event, set for Friday, aims to unite the community and support local businesses during the holiday season. KTVH
- ➤ Helena's Parks, Recreation and Open Lands Department has reintroduced the Postcards from Santa program, allowing children to receive a reply from Santa when they send him a letter via special mailboxes set up around Helena. Independent Record
- ➤ Governor Greg Gianforte and volunteers harvested Montana's 2024 Capitol Christmas tree from Bozeman's trust lands, continuing a tradition that supports active forest management. KXLH
CRIME NEWS
- ➤ Former federal judge Sam E. Haddon settled a wrongful death lawsuit outside of court with the victim's family following a fatal car crash in April, where negligence was claimed. Independent Record
- ➤ Daren Abbey pleaded not guilty to charges of deliberate homicide and tampering with evidence after being accused of killing Dustin Kjersem in Montana. KXLH
ENVIRONMENT NEWS
- ➤ Helena begins its annual prescribed burning in city open lands to maintain forest health, focusing on slash piles on Mount Ascension and Mount Helena. Independent Record
HEALTH NEWS
- ➤ St. Peter's Health introduces a free challenge to encourage activity during Montana's winter. KTVH
